The on-board fresh water system is pressurized by a self-
priming, 12-volt DC pump. The pump operates automatically
when the pump power switch is ON and a faucet is opened.
When the faucets are closed, the pump shuts off. At free flow,
the pump draws approximately 7 to 7V, amps. A 7V,-amp fuse
at the converter panel protects the pump circuit. It can run dry
for extended periods without damage. See Electrical Systems
chapter. See illustration for pump location.
Turn the pump switch ON to pressurize the system. When a
faucet is opened after the initial filling of the tank; the water
may sputter for a few seconds. This is normal and is not cause
for concern. The water flow will become steady when all air
is bled from the water lines.
Dirt, mineral scale, and organic matter are filtered out of the
fresh water system by an in-line water filter on the inlet side
of the water pump. If you suspect a clogged filter, it is easily
removed and cleaned.
Inspect the filter after running the first full tank of water.
Clean and inspect monthly thereafter. See illustration for filter
location.
1. Loosen the clamp at the inlet end of the filter.
2. Pull the water line off the filter.
3. Unscrew the filter from the water pump.
4. Turn each end of the filter and pull apart.
5. Flush out and clean screen.
6. Reverse procedure to install.
7. Operate the water pump and check for leaks.
